Analysis
In 2018, pisa: female 15-year-olds by mathematics proficiency level (%). level in Poland stood at 20.8%. That is the lowest value across all 6 years on record.
That represents a change of down 12.3% on the previous year and down 17.8% over ten years.
Over the whole period, pisa: female 15-year-olds by mathematics proficiency level (%). level in Poland peaked at 26.8% in 2003 and was at its lowest, 20.8%, in 2018.
That places Poland 41st out of 53 countries with data for 2018, putting it in the bottom quarter.

About this data
Percentage of 15-year-old female students scoring higher than 420 but lower than or equal to 482 points on the PISA mathematics scale. At Level 2, students can interpret and recognize situations in contexts that require no more than direct inference. They can extract relevant information from a single source and make use of a single representational mode. Students at this level can employ basic algorithms, formulae, procedures, or conventions to solve problems involving whole numbers. They are capable of making literal interpretations of the results. Data reflects country performance in the stated year according to PISA reports, but may not be comparable across years or countries.
